2026 Arnold Palmer Invitational prize money
Akshay Bhatia won the 2026 Arnold Palmer Invitational on 8 March 2026 and took $4,000,000. Below is every one of the 49 cheques paid that week, in finishing order, down to the $54,000 Brian Harman collected for finishing 50.
Akshay Bhatia won it in a playoff, so the card shows the same 72-hole total at the top of the ladder twice.

The top of the ladder
The fifteen biggest cheques of the week took $14,807,600 between them, against $5,140,400 shared by the other 34 players paid.
The 49 cheques above come to $19,948,000 between them. We hold 71 players for the week in all, so 22 of them took no money: a missed cut, a withdrawal or an amateur place. A place written as T4 is a tie, and everyone tied for it was paid the same.

Frequently asked questions
Who won the 2026 Arnold Palmer Invitational?
Akshay Bhatia, on 8 March 2026, in a playoff. The win paid $4,000,000.
How much did the 2026 Arnold Palmer Invitational pay out?
The 49 cheques on this page come to $19,948,000 between them, from $4,000,000 at the top down to $54,000.
What was the smallest cheque at the 2026 Arnold Palmer Invitational?
$54,000, which Brian Harman collected for finishing 50.
How many players were paid at the 2026 Arnold Palmer Invitational?
49. We hold 71 players for that week in all, so 22 of them took no money: a missed cut, a withdrawal or an amateur place.
